Section 3 — Connections
Microphone / Line In
The LINE/MIC IN section provides combined XLR/TRS 1/4’’ connectors
as inputs:
•
4 x XLR
•
4 x TRS 1/4’’ (the TRS 1/4’’ phone connectors are located in the middle
of the combined connectors and can be used instead of XLR)
Figure 9. Combined XLR/TRS 1/4’’ connector
Note
Phantom power (+48 V DC) can be activated for Line/Mic inputs 1/2 and 3/4.
Note
The LINE/MIC IN inputs can be amplified (see Mixer Submenu on page 97).
Digital Audio Input
The INDIGO AV Mixer provides the following connections for digital
audio input:
•
6 x AES/EBU (25-pin Sub-D connector, section DIGITAL AUDIO I/O)
De-embedded/Embedded Audio (SDI)
Audio can also be derived (de-embedded) from up to six SDI video inputs
(see Audio Submenu on page 129).
For all SDI outputs, audio is embedded in Main and Sub channels in pairs
1+2 and 3+4.
Note
De-embedded audio signals may be automatically delayed according to their
related video signals to avoid offset when being processed and re-embedded
on output.
